What education do you need to become a security systems sales representative?

What degree do you need to be a security systems sales representative?

The most common degree for security systems sales representatives is bachelor's degree, with 51% of security systems sales representatives earning that degree. The second and third most common degree levels are associate degree degree at 22% and associate degree degree at 10%.
  • Bachelor's, 51%
  • Associate, 22%
  • Master's, 10%
  • High School Diploma, 10%
  • Other Degrees, 7%

What should I major in to become a security systems sales representative?

You should major in business to become a security systems sales representative. 19% of security systems sales representatives major in business. Other common majors for a security systems sales representative include computer science and criminal justice.

Average security systems sales representative salary by education level

Security systems sales representatives with a Master's degree earn more than those without, at $56,004 annually. With a Doctorate degree, security systems sales representatives earn a median annual income of $51,151 compared to $43,887 for security systems sales representatives with an Bachelor's degree.
Security systems sales representative education levelSecurity systems sales representative salary
Master's Degree$56,004
High School Diploma or Less$23,641
Bachelor's Degree$43,887
Doctorate Degree$51,151
Some College/ Associate Degree$25,728
